Rigidity of nonconvex polyhedra with respect to edge lengths and dihedral angles

Abstract

We prove that every three-dimensional polyhedron is uniquely determined by its dihedral angles and edge lengths, even if nonconvex or self-intersecting, under two plausible sufficient conditions: (i) the polyhedron has only convex faces and (ii) it does not have partially-flat vertices, and under an additional technical requirement that (iii) any triple of vertices is not collinear. The proof is consistently valid for Euclidean, hyperbolic and spherical geometry, which takes a completely different approach from the argument of the Cauchy rigidity theorem. Various counterexamples are provided that arise when these conditions are violated, and self-contained proofs are presented whenever possible. As a corollary, the rigidity of several families of polyhedra is also established. Finally, we propose two conjectures: the first suggests that Condition (iii) can be removed, and the second concerns the rigidity of spherical nonconvex polygons.<br />Comment: 27 pages, 20 figures
